Understanding Chronic Pain and Kratom's Role
Chronic pain is a complex condition that affects millions worldwide, often persisting for months or even years. It’s defined as ongoing pain that exceeds the normal process of healing and can significantly impact daily life. This persistent pain can stem from various sources, including injuries, conditions like arthritis or fibromyalgia, or even certain medical treatments. Traditional management strategies typically involve medications, physical therapy, and psychological interventions, but for many, these methods fall short in providing adequate relief.
Kratom, derived from the tropical plant Mitragyna speciosa, has emerged as a potential natural solution for chronic pain management. The kratom strain chart categorises different varieties based on their unique chemical profiles, offering a range of effects. Certain strains are known to possess analgesic properties, interacting with opioid receptors in the brain and body, which could help alleviate chronic pain. However, it’s essential to approach kratom as part of a comprehensive treatment plan, as individual responses can vary, and further research is needed to fully understand its efficacy and safety for long-term use.
Exploring the Kratom Strain Chart: Varieties for Different Needs
Kratom, a natural herb derived from the plant Mitragyna speciosa, comes in various strains, each with unique properties and effects. Exploring the kratom strain chart is essential for individuals seeking chronic pain management as it allows them to choose the most suitable variety for their specific needs. These strains differ in their chemical composition, primarily due to variations in alkaloid content, particularly mitragynine and 7-hydroxymitragynine.
The kratom strain chart typically categorizes these varieties based on their dominant effects, which can range from energizing and stimulating to calming and soothing. For instance, red strains are known for their pain-relieving and relaxing properties, making them popular choices for managing chronic pain and promoting sleep. On the other hand, green strains often offer a more balanced combination of energy and relaxation, suitable for daytime use or individuals seeking increased focus while mitigating pain. Understanding these variations enables users to make informed decisions, ensuring they find the right kratom strain to effectively manage their chronic pain symptoms.
